If you're just looking for a place to park your rig and sleep at night after a day of sightseeing in Tucson, this place may be enough. Otherwise, it's a disappointment. No amenities whatsoever, just full hookups. The sewer hookup is difficult to use, though; it's so far to the back and you need to have a long hose. No cable and the wi-fi was practically non-existent. On the other hand, the site we got was fairly wide and level and there are desert trails nearbly. It's also quite clean. Never saw the campground host, though.

We stayed here in a Class C Motorhome.
